How do I repair Windows Media Player in Windows 10?
Press key + R, Windows also type “%LOCALAPPDATA%\Microsoft” and press Enter. The Microsoft system folder will open.
Find the media player folder. Right-click by clicking on it, press Shift and click on the “Delete” theme.
Restart your computer. Even when Windows starts, Windows Media Player restores the Windows Media Player database.
